Is 644 747 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 644 747 is about 802.961.

Thus, the square root of 644 747 is not an integer, and therefore 644 747 is not a square number.

Anyway, 644 747 is a prime number, and a prime number cannot be a perfect square.

What is the square number of 644 747?

The square of a number (here 644 747) is the result of the product of this number (644 747) by itself (i.e., 644 747 × 644 747); the square of 644 747 is sometimes called "raising 644 747 to the power 2", or "644 747 squared".

The square of 644 747 is 415 698 694 009 because 644 747 × 644 747 = 644 7472 = 415 698 694 009.

As a consequence, 644 747 is the square root of 415 698 694 009.
